SchoolRow ranks Independence Jr High School 96th of 685 Illinois middle schools for 2024–25, based on Illinois Report Card 2024–25 English and Math results — better than 86% of middle schools statewide. Its statewide percentile went from 80th in 2019 to 86th in 2025 — improving.

Racial and ethnic breakdown of 208 students (2023–24, NCES) — history since 1988, with comparable seven-category changes from 2010
| Group | Trend | 2010 | 2023 | Change |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| White | 86.6% | 71.6% | ▼ 15.0 pts | |
| Hispanic | 10.2% | 19.7% | ▲ 9.5 pts | |
| Black | 2.4% | 5.8% | ▲ 3.4 pts | |
| Two or more races | 0.4% | 1.9% | ▲ 1.5 pts | |
| Asian | 0.0% | 1.0% | ▲ 1.0 pts |
NCES history for this school begins in 1988. Race categories changed by 2010: earlier data combines Asian and Pacific Islander students and does not consistently identify multiracial students. The chart retains that history, while the change table uses 2010 onward.
